Attorneys Attend 2021 NAPABA Convention

Larson LLP is a proud sponsor of the 2021 National Asian Pacific American Bar Association (NAPABA) Convention, which is being held in Washington, D.C., and virtually Dec. 9-12.

Associates Nicole J. Kim and John Lee and counsel Jen C. Won are virtually attending the event, which connects Asian Pacific American (APA) attorneys from Fortune 500 companies, federal and state courts, law firms, and public interest sectors across North America.

Jen is actively involved on the NAPABA Board of Governors, serving as the Central California Regional Governor, a member of the Executive Committee, and the chair of the Finance Committee. Nicole and John are members of NAPABA.

The firm is pleased to support organizations such as NAPABA who provide a voice for increased diversity in government and the judiciary, advocate for equal opportunity in the workplace, work to eliminate hate crimes and anti-immigrant sentiment, and promote the professional development of people of color in the legal profession. 

About NAPABA

In 1988, a coalition of APA bar leaders from around the country came together to create a national voice of engaged and active lawyers to support their community. Since then, NAPABA has grown to become the nation’s largest APA membership organization, representing the interest of 50,000 attorneys, judges, law professors, and law students.
